Texto completo da fonteThis thesis is part of the training simulator of the "Digital Reactor" project with the aim of integrating the modelling of degradation, aging and failures. Indeed, the objective is to allow driving operators to train themselves to react in the event of dysfunctional behaviours in their system, which are bound to deteriorate, as well as to allow them to evaluate the impact of their driving strategy on the system over a longer period of time. To meet this need, and in particular to represent the link between dysfunctional and functional behaviours, the work of this thesis focused on the extension of the concept of ASH. This is to consider in the first place the degradation, its evolution, its impact on the failure rate before allowing these models to receive control injections during simulation, allowing them to be used in the context of training sessions. Then, to extend them once again by linking the degradation to the performance of the modelled component through drifts such as sensor or control drift, this creating the ASHBP. In addition to this modelling tool, the work of this thesis focused on the development of an independent modular software, the MCM2D that can be integrated into the co-simulation environment that is the training simulator of the "Digital Reactor". To do this, it was necessary to carry out studies and developments on the synchronization between the models and the MCM2D as well as with the other software of the training simulator. The MCM2D is made up of four modules, each with a specific mission. The MSD simulates a complex system in real-time or accelerated by enabling communications with third-party software and command injections for training sessions. The MV allows for accelerated simulation to age the system components simulated by the MSD. The MP allows Monte Carlo simulations to be carried out to study the impact of a maintenance strategy on the modelled system. Finally, in order to allow a human user to communicate and inject commands into the MCM2D and its modules, the MIG allows the use of an HMI. This MCM2D was integrated into the training simulator of the "Digital Reactor" project to model a Hand Control Relay (HCR) during a "Bubble Collapse" scenario using various scenarios showing: the phenomenon of control drift, a control blocking behaviour, an example of accelerated use with control injection and an example of a prognostic study on the impact of a maintenance strategy. Through these demonstrations, it is shown that ASHBP can be used to model the evolution of degradation according to the use profile allowing to keep in memory the life of the modelled component. In addition, these can be used both in the Monte Carlo simulation framework but also in the training simulation framework with variable command injections and calculation time steps according to the user's needs. Finally, it has been shown that the simulation environment of these automata, the MCM2D, can be integrated into a multi-software environment while being able to be modified in the future to perform a wider variety of missions by adding new modules. This thesis presents work both in the field of dynamic modelling of systems, as well as in the field of training simulation

Texto completo da fonteThe research of analytical solutions for reliability assessment in dynamic context is not solved in the general case. A state of the art presented in chapter 1 shows that partial approaches exist in the case of particular hypothesis. The Monte Carlo simulation would be the only recourse, but there were no tools allowing the simultaneous simulation of the discrete evolution of the system and its continuous evolution taking into account the probabilistic aspects. In this context, in chapter 2, we introduce the concept of hybrid stochastic automaton capable of taking into account all the problems posed by dynamic reliability and to accede to the assessment of dependability parameters by a Monte Carlo simulation implemented in Scicos-Scilab environment. In chapter 3, we show the effectiveness of our approach of simulation for dependability assessment in dynamic context through two test cases of which case one is a benchmark of dependability community. Our approach responds to the posed problems, notably the consideration of the influence of the discrete state, of the continuous state and their interaction, in the probabilistic assessment of the performances of a system in which besides, the reliability characteristics of components depend themselves of the continuous and discrete states. In chapter 4, we give an idea of the interest of control by supervision as a means of dependability. The concepts of observer automaton and of controller have been introduced and illustrated on our test case in order to show their potential
